Summer is here - you can't miss it, you can't ignore it and you certainly can't overfeel it. The siesta suddenly becomes a survival strategy, the fan your new best friend, and even the cat thinks twice about moving from the patch of shade.

But: as much as the sun sometimes glows - the warm months bring out the best. Spontaneous conversations on the plaza, evenings that only get going around midnight and the smell of charcoal, sun cream and fresh sea fish in the air.
Summer on the Costa Blanca is not just a season, it's a state. Between mild madness, Mediterranean lightness and the good feeling that at some point the evening wind will cool everything down again.

Of course, everything is a little more crowded than in March, the car park in front of the supermarket is a rare commodity, and yes - someone is always barbecuing, even at half past two. But that's just what you get:
